Lana (river)

The 883rd longest river in the world

km

Lana is a river in central Albania that flows through the city of Tirana. A tributary of the Ishmi river basin, it originates on the western slopes of Qafa e Priskës and traverses the Albanian capital before joining the Tirana River near Bërxullë.

Flows through: Albania.
